That's the key piece of info. 4A will actually be worse in that scenario. If you're just in Drive, the transmission will shift as you pick up speed. Use Manual mode and leave it in 1st, maybe 2nd. Let the engine braking keep your speed down. This will also reduce the need to ride your brakes...
